Summary

Insufficient validation of untrusted input in the Media component of Google Chrome prior to version 150.0.7871.47 allows a remote attacker who has compromised the renderer process to potentially escape the sandbox via a crafted video file.

Risk Assessment

The risk for the organization is the potential escalation from a compromised renderer process to full system compromise, leading to data confidentiality and integrity breaches. Although the severity is low in Chromium's scale, it can pose a security threat in corporate environments.

Recommendation

Immediately update Google Chrome to version 150.0.7871.47 or later. Consider restricting playback of video files from untrusted sources.
